I encountered a CFF font that caused problems when rendering a PDF file
in Xpdf.  I'm not 100% certain, but it looks like the problem is an
hstem operator with a bogus (very large) y value.  That appears to be
causing FreeType to return a tall bitmap with an incorrect bitmap_top
value.

I'm attaching f2.cff.  To reproduce the problem, run "ftview 24 f2.cff"
and look at the i, j, and fi glyphs.  If you resize the ftview window
~4x taller, you'll see that the glyphs show up much lower than expected.

(I manually edited the font file and modified the hstem y value to 0
for the 'i' glyph, and that fixed the problem, at least visually in
ftview.)

Maybe better to simply ignore hints that are outside the FontBBox?  In
any case, I think the bitmap_top value needs to be fixed, so that the
origin is in the right place.

I'm running FreeType 2.12.1.
